CSS3規(guī)范重復了部分CSS的內(nèi)容,并在其基礎(chǔ)上進行了很多增補和修改。
CSS3新特征:
1、強大的CSS3選擇器;
2、創(chuàng)建特殊的視覺效果(圓角,陰影,漸變背景,半透明,圖片邊框等);
3、背景添加了多個屬性值(background-origin,background-clip,background-size);
4、盒子模型的變化(CSS3彈性盒子);
5、多列布局和彈性盒模型布局(Flexible Box);?
6、Web字體和Web Font圖標(@font-face);
7、顏色與透明度(HSL,HSLA,RGBA);
8、盒容器的變形(2D,3D);
9、CSS3過渡與動畫效果(translation,animation);
10、媒體特性與響應式布局;
使用CSS3的好處:
1、讓你的網(wǎng)站更加炫酷,使網(wǎng)站設(shè)計錦上添花。
2、減少開發(fā)與維護的成本。減少為了實現(xiàn)圓角與陰影等效果時,圖片的使用和添加、嵌套多余的元素;同時使用CSS3實現(xiàn)動畫或者過渡效果,減少了Javascript代碼的數(shù)量。
3、提高頁面性能。當頁面上嵌套的元素,圖片等資源減少,用戶打開網(wǎng)頁時需要加載的內(nèi)容就越少,打開網(wǎng)站的速度就越快,更少的圖片,腳本以及flash文件可以減少HTTP請求的數(shù)目,